Union Tank Car
Company has purchased the Plas-Chem line of protective
coatings and paints from East Texas Coatings, Inc.
April 17, 2000 - Chicago, IL - Union
Tank Car Company has purchased the Plas-Chem line of
protective coatings and paints from East Texas Coatings, Inc.
Frank D. Lester, Union Tank Car president, made the
announcement. Plas-Chem coating formulations include epoxies,
organic and inorganic zincs, urethanes, vinyl esters and
alkyds used to paint exteriors and to coat interiors of
railroad tank cars and plastics hopper cars. "An epoxy
tank coating used in caustic soda and molten sulfur cars is
the prize for Union Tank Car," explained Lester. "Plas-Chem
2310 has a long, successful track record and is competitive
from a VOC compliance perspective with all similar families of
coatings. But most important, it does not have the
health-suspect ingredients found in some competitor epoxy tank
car coatings." "The entire group of Plas-Chem
formulations melds, essentially without overlaps, with Union
Tank Car's line of Lithcote high-bake phenolic coatings. We
soon will be able to offer our customers an even more complete
line of proprietary coating applications in which Union Tank
Car has control of and takes responsibility for the material
as well as the installation. First, though, our North America
Coatings Department will investigate, analyze and improve
those Plas-Chem materials with the most immediate
applicability to our customers' needs," said Lester.
